Abstract
This paper explores the role of human resources (HR) in managing organizational change within civil society organizations (CSOs), with a focus on strengthening their capacity for adaptation and long-term sustainability. It emphasizes the importance of adopting a change management approach underpinned by organizational development (OD)
principles to address the operational and strategic challenges that CSOs face in an evolving social landscape. Using case study methodology, this study involved an in-depth organizational diagnosis of 11 CSOs actively working on Sustainable Development Goals over two weeks. It argues that strong leadership is essential for initiating and guiding change, while stakeholder engagement fosters buying and ensures that the needs of all parties are considered.
